Stir Fried Asparagus With Quinoa2
quinoa -
1 cup quinoa
2 cups water
asparagus -
1 lb fresh asparagus - wash; slice diagonally into 2 inch pieces
2 tsp olive oil
salt and pepper, to taste


Quinoa - Quinoa is a grain that is a good source of protein, calcium, and
iron. It can be found in most health food stores. Rinse quinoa in cool
water. Bring 2 cups water to a boil. Add quinoa and simmer for 15 min.

Heat oil in a medium frying pan. Add asparagus and salt and pepper. Stir
constantly until asparagus is tender but still somewhat crisp
(approximately 5 minutes)

Combine quinoa and asparagus or serve separately if desired.

Makes 4 servings:

Per serving: 200 calories 35 g carbohydrate 5.5 g fiber 24 g protein 4 g
fat
